Anybody have any idea how many lumens this head lamp produces on high?

They put out about 35 Lumens. However, because it's not voltage regulated, its brightness will diminish fairly rapidly (you will start to see less light about 15-20 minutes of use). Check out the Princeton Tec Quad for a brighter headlamp (45 Lumens), one that's voltage regulated (meaning it will maintain the high output longer), has a battery indicator, includes a lifetime warranty, and is 100% waterproof. It's also made in the USA and costs about the same.
